1 VCT units 2 Intake camshaft VCT solenoid 3 Camshaft position sensors 4 Exhaust camshaft VCT solenoid The VCT system varies the timing of the intake and exhaust camshafts to deliver optimum engine power, efficiency and emissions. The timing of the intake camshafts has a range of 62 degrees of crankshaft angle. The timing of the exhaust
camshafts has a range of 50 degrees of crankshaft angle.
In the base timing position:
The intake camshafts are fully retarded.
The exhaust camshafts are fully advanced.
VCT Operating Ranges
Camshaft Valve Opens Valve Closes Intake 29 degrees BTDC (before top dead center) to 33 degrees ATDC (after top dead center) 207 to 269 degrees ATDC Exhaust 244 to 194 degrees BTDC 6 to 56 degrees ATDC The system consists of a VCT unit and a VCT solenoid for each camshaft. The ECM controls the system using PWM (pulse width modulation) signals to the VCT solenoids.
The torsional energy generated by the valve springs and the inertia of the valve train components are used to operate the
system. Variable Camshaft Timing

Variable Camshaft Timing Operation
When the engine is running, the compression and expansion of the valve springs causes momentary increases and decreases
in the torque acting on the camshafts. These momentary changes of torque are sensed in the VCT units and used to change the camshaft timing.
